Valve's Steam Machine vs. P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X: A Gaming Hardware Comparison

Valve’s latest offering, the Steam Machine, aims to revolutionize the gaming landscape by transforming PC gaming into an accessible living room console format. In a detailed analysis, Waypoint explores how this new hardware stacks up against the current titans of the console world: the P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X|S.

RAM and Storage Space

To better understand these machines’ performance, a critical examination of their RAM and storage capabilities reveals significant differences. Each of these gaming consoles has distinct specs that dictate how many games can be stored locally and the overall speed of their operations:

  • Steam Machine: Comes equipped with 16GB of DDR5 for system performance, 8GB of GDDR6 dedicated video RAM, and offers storage options of 512GB or 2TB NVMe SSD. Additionally, both models feature a high-speed microSD card slot for expanded storage.
  • PlayStation 5: Features 16GB of GDDR6 RAM and an 825GB custom NVMe SSD, providing a balance between speed and storage.
  • Xbox Series X: Offers 16GB of GDDR6 RAM and provides a choice between 1TB or 2TB custom NVMe SSD storage, thereby allowing for a more flexible gaming library.

CPU and Graphics Card

The engines driving these systems are equally crucial in determining their overall performance and graphical output:

  • Steam Machine: Powered by a custom AMD Zen 4 CPU with 6 cores and 12 threads, combined with an AMD RDNA 3 graphics card boasting 28 compute units.
  • PlayStation 5: Utilizes a custom AMD Zen 2 processor with 8 cores and 16 threads clocking at 3.5GHz, alongside an AMD RDNA 2 GPU with 36 compute units.
  • Xbox Series X: Equipped with 8 cores at 3.8GHz (3.6GHz with simultaneous multithreading) based on a custom Zen 2 architecture, featuring a powerful RDNA 2 GPU capable of 12 TFLOPS and 52 compute units running at 1.825GHz.

When compared, these machines are relatively on par regarding performance, although Valve aims for a balance of affordability and functionality with its Steam Machine. While its graphics performance may not match that of its competitors due to less dedicated VRAM, the newer Zen 4 architecture potentially offsets this shortcoming, enhancing overall performance.

Handheld Gaming: Steam Deck vs. Nintendo Switch 2

In the realm of handheld gaming, the Steam Deck (OLED Model) faces off against the anticipated Nintendo Switch 2. The analysis also briefly touches upon other competitors like the PlayStation Portal and ROG Ally X, which each offer unique advantages.

CPU and Graphics Comparisons

  • Nintendo Switch 2: Powered by a custom NVIDIA T239 processor featuring 8 ARM Cortex A78C cores.
  • Steam Deck: Runs on a custom AMD Zen 2 CPU with 4 cores and 8 threads.

From a graphics standpoint:

  • Nintendo Switch 2: Utilizes an NVIDIA Ampere architecture.
  • Steam Deck: Equipped with 8 RDNA 2 compute units running at 1.6GHz.

RAM and Storage Space

In terms of memory and storage:

  • Nintendo Switch 2: Contains 12GB of unified LPDDR5X RAM and offers 256GB of storage.
  • Steam Deck: Provides 16GB of unified LPDDR5 RAM and comes with 512GB or 1TB NVMe SSD options.

In comparing these handheld devices, the Steam Deck holds the edge in RAM, which can facilitate better performance, whereas the Switch 2 benefits from enhanced GPU capabilities and a more modern processing architecture. Ultimately, gamers may lean more towards their desired game library and user experience rather than solely evaluating raw computational power.

The Steam Machine is designed to provide gamers the ability to play a vast array of Steam’s PC titles with the convenience of a console, while the Nintendo Switch 2 highlights exclusive gameplay experiences, showcasing the distinctive approaches both devices take to attract a diverse gaming audience.
